Summary
Includes brief statements that the Australian continent was isolated very early in the world's history, so the Indigenous people had obviously lived in isolation for long ages, had no cultivated plants, the bow and arrow were unknown to them, they were nomads, and most of the 52,000 surviving live in the arid central section of the great plateau p. 13; provides an overview of Indigenous history, culture and lifestyle p. 171-172
